CONSOLIDATED NEWFOUNDLAND AND LABRADOR REGULATION 672/96

Notice of Protected Water Supply Area
under the
Environment Act
(O.C. 96-153)

Under the authority of section 10 of the Environment Act and the Subordinate Legislation Revision and Consolidation Act, the Lieutenant-Governor in Council designates the area generally known as the Paddocks Pond Water Supply Area as a protected water supply area.

NOTICE

This area includes all lands described as follows:

That is to say by a line drawn from military grid reference 586000 5489000 72°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 200 metres to the commencement point;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 123°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 675 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 187°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 550 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 193°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 525 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 303°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 650 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 353°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 175 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 279°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 375 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 358°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 200 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 61°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 550 metres;

Then from the above point by a line drawn 16° 00' grid azimuth for a distance of 350 metres to the point of commencement.

All bearings refer to Grid North.
